Granite flame finishing internal burner

This patent describes an internal burner for producing subsonic air-fuel flame jets for the flame finishing of granite and similar stone; a first nozzle within the body of relatively small diameter d{sub 1} at an exit end of the combustion chamber to expand the products to supersonic velocity, a duct of sufficiently large diameter within the body downstream of the first nozzle and open thereto to convert the jet of hot gases to subsonic velocity by shock action for discharging hot gas product of combustion, and a second nozzle having a larger diameter d{sub 2} than the diameter d{sub 1} of the first nozzle within the body open to the duct and at the end of the duct opposite the first nozzle whereby a subsonic flame jet is produced to be directed against the rock surface.
